What Is a GH Pump? A Practical Definition

In simple terms, a GH pump is a centrifugal pump designed primarily to handle water and wastewater with high efficiency and low energy consumption. It’s distinguished by its mechanical seal, impeller design, and build materials that allow it to work reliably across a wide range of conditions.

More than just machinery, the GH pump connects industrial processing needs with humanitarian efforts—think post-flood drainage, rural water supply, or large-scale irrigation projects.

Core Components and Key Factors

1. Durability

Many engineers say the GH pump’s robust casing and corrosion-resistant components make it ideal for harsh environments. Whether handling abrasive slurry or corrosive liquids, its design minimizes wear and tear over time.

2. Energy Efficiency

Energy consumption is a major factor in operational cost. The GH pump often incorporates hydrodynamic improvements—like optimized impeller blades—that reduce power usage without compromising flow rate.

3. Scalability

From small-scale farm irrigation to large municipal waterworks, GH pumps come in multiple sizes and power options, allowing businesses and communities to scale their projects seamlessly.

4. Maintenance Simplicity

Ease of access to critical parts and a modular approach make routine servicing quicker and cheaper, cutting downtime. Operators often share that a GH pump’s service manuals and vendor support truly matter when things get tough.

5. Cost Efficiency

Compared to other centrifugal pumps, the GH type tends to deliver a lower upfront cost while maintaining excellent lifecycle value, especially when factoring in reduced energy and repair bills.

Mini Takeaway: The GH pump’s core strengths blend robustness, efficiency, and flexibility, making it a trusted choice across industries.

Future Trends and Innovations in GH Pump Technology

Looking ahead, the GH pump sector is feeling the buzz of green energy and digital transformation. Solar-powered GH pump systems are becoming mainstream in off-grid areas, which is nothing short of a game changer.

There’s also a push toward IoT-enabled smart pumps that send real-time performance data to operators, ensuring early detection of issues before failures happen. Automation in pump control means less dependency on manual monitoring, which, frankly, is a relief for many field engineers.

Materials science advances are introducing composites and alloys that reduce weight yet resist corrosion even better, stretching pump life cycles and shrinking environmental footprints.

Challenges and Practical Solutions

No product is perfect, so what about the GH pump? One challenge is susceptibility to solids clogging, especially in wastewater or slurry applications. However, manufacturers are addressing this with redesigned impellers and self-cleaning features.

Another issue sometimes faced is the upfront cost barrier for low-income users. Innovative financing models and community-shared pump installations seek to bridge this gap.

Training remains essential and often overlooked. Partnering with suppliers that offer robust technician education can raise uptime significantly.

FAQ: Your Top Questions About GH Pumps

Q1: What types of fluids can GH pumps handle?

GH pumps are optimized primarily for water and wastewater, but certain models tackle slightly abrasive or chemically mild liquids. It’s always important to check material compatibility before deployment.

Q2: How energy-efficient are GH pumps compared to other centrifugal pumps?

Due to advanced impeller design and better sealing, GH pumps generally reduce energy consumption by around 10-15%, which adds up over time in operational savings.

Q3: Can GH pumps be used in remote or off-grid locations?

Absolutely. Many GH pumps pair excellently with solar or diesel generators, making them suitable for isolated villages or construction sites without easy electricity access.

Q4: How frequently should GH pumps be serviced?

Recommended maintenance intervals depend on usage intensity but typically fall between every 6 to 12 months. More frequent checks help avoid unexpected downtime, especially in critical applications.
